Rising Sun-Lebanon has a livability score of 59/100 and is ranked #65 in Delaware and #19,412 in the USA. This score ranks well below the United States average. With such a low livability score, it might be worth investigating a little further. If we dig a little deeper into each category within the livability score, we see that Rising Sun-Lebanon has higher than average rankings for the following: crime (A-), employment (B+) and housing (A). Rising Sun-Lebanon does not score well for the following: amenities (F) and education (F). It might be wise to take a closer look at each category to find out why.

Having said that, perhaps the most important metric to consider when contemplating a move to Rising Sun-Lebanon is real estate affordability. The median home price for Rising Sun-Lebanon homes is $514,229, which is 22.4% higher than the Delaware average. If we take a closer look at the affordability of homes in Rising Sun-Lebanon, we’ll see that the home price to income ratio is 5.3, which is 12.8% higher than the Delaware average.

      Rising Sun-Lebanon transportation information

      Statistic Rising Sun-Lebanon Delaware National
      Average one way commute25min26min26min
      Workers who drive to work83.4%81.3%76.4%
      Workers who carpool12.0%8.2%9.3%
      Workers who take public transit0.0%2.9%5.1%
      Workers who bicycle0.0%0.3%0.6%
      Workers who walk0.0%2.1%2.8%
      Working from home3.5%4.3%4.6%
      Source: The Rising Sun-Lebanon, DE data and statistics displayed above are derived from the United States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) and include 2026 modeled data developed using proprietary methodologies.
